      Hi

      Would anyone out there be able to recommend where to go for night life, reasonable price would be nice, maybe with music.  We will be there for a week in May.

          Portia,

          The very first cocktail I would have would be at The Ritz, Place Vendome, in Hemmingways.  This historic place can be a challenge, but just go into the Hotel and go way to the back, follow the signs!  It is a moving experience and very relaxing place to have a refreshment you will never forget.  

          They do not allow camera's but remind yourself of the famous that have been there and the last place Princes Di was at before the tragedy. From there, as the bartender, and follow the yellow brick road.

            For a romantic, music filled evening, relax one night at Monmartre.

            Just be careful of the panhandlers on the outskirts on the area.  Just take a taxi directly to Sacre Coeur and you can avoid problems.  You have a great array of medium priced places and music galore!

            Our favorite is the tiny, Le Poulbot, (See picture), a three course meal that is great is around 11 Euro's!.  There are all kind of sidewalk cafe's that are great as well!

            Enjoy!

              Parisians know their city by numbered neighborhood districts called, 'ar-ron-dise-ments'.  My personal favorites include the cafes along the Boulevard Montparnasse in the Sixth Arrondisement, and the nightclubs located along the winding streets of St. Germaine des Pres and Quartier Latin (Latin Quarter) in the Left Bank.
